In dry conditions moisture from the humidifier will be absorbed by walls, furniture, and other items in your room. Ventilation of dry outside air will also 
increase the time it takes to reach the target humidity.
To optimize humidification performance, it’s recommended to close doors and windows during use.

Important safety information 

Read this important information carefully before you use the appliance and 
save it for future reference.

Danger

• 

Do not spray any flammable materials such as 

insecticides or fragrance around the appliance. 

• 

Do not clean the appliance with water, any other liquid, 

or a (flammable) detergent to avoid electric shock and/

or a fire hazard. 

• 

The water in the water tank is not suitable for drinking. 

Do not drink this water and do not use it to feed 

animals or to water plants. When you empty the water 

tank, pour the water down the drain.

Warning

• 

Check if the voltage indicated on the appliance 

corresponds to the local mains voltage before you 

connect the appliance. 

• 

If the supply cord is damaged, you must have it 

replaced by Philips, a service center authorized by 

Philips, or similarly qualified persons in order to avoid 

a hazard.

• 

Do not use the appliance if the plug, the power cord, or 

the appliance itself is damaged.

• 

This appliance can be used by children aged from 8 

years and above and persons with reduced physical, 

sensory or mental capabilities or lack of experience 

and knowledge if they have been given supervision or 

instruction concerning use of the appliance in a safe 

way and understand the hazards involved. Children 

shall not play with the appliance. Cleaning and user 

maintenance shall not be made by children without 

supervision.

• 

Do not insert your fingers or objects into the air 

outlet or the air inlet to prevent physical injury or 

malfunctioning of the appliance. 

• 

Make sure that foreign objects do not fall into the 

appliance through the air outlet. 

Caution

• 

The appliance is only intended for household use 

under normal operating conditions. 

• 

Always place and use the appliance on a dry, stable, 

flat and horizontal surface. 

• 

Do not block the air inlet and outlet. 

• 

Do not place anything on top of the appliance and do 

not sit or stand on the appliance. 

• 

Only use the original Philips filter specially intended 

for this appliance. Do not use any other filter. 

• 

Do not fill water from the air outlets on top of the 

appliance. 

• 

Only fill the water tank with cold tap water. Do not use 

ground water or hot water. 

• 

Do not put any substance other than water in the water 

tank. Do not add fragrance or chemical substance into 

the water. Use only water (tap, purified, mineral, any 

sort of potable water). 

• 

Avoid knocking against the appliance (the air inlet and 

outlet in particular) with hard objects. 

• 

Do not use the appliance near gas appliances, heating 

devices or fireplaces. 

• 

Do not place the appliance directly below an air 

conditioner to prevent condensation from dripping 

onto the appliance. 

• 

Do not use this appliance when you have used indoor 

smoke-type insect repellents or in places with oily 

residues, burning incense, or chemical fumes. 

• 

Do not use the appliance in wet surroundings or in 

surroundings with high ambient temperatures, such as 

the bathroom, toilet, or kitchen, or in a room with major 

temperature changes. 

• 

Always unplug the appliance when you want to move, 

clean appliance, fill the water, replace the filter or carry 

out maintenance.

• 

Do not wash the filter in a washing machine or dish 

washer, otherwise the filter will be deformed. 

• 

When the appliance is not used for a long time, 

bacteria and mold may grow on the filter. Clean the 

water tank and dry the humidification filter. Check the 

filter before you start using the appliance again. If the 

filter is very dirty with dark spots, replace it.

Recycling

Do not throw away the product with the normal household waste at the end of 
its life, but hand it in at an official collection point for recycling. By doing this, 
you help to preserve the environment.
Follow your country’s rules for the separate collection of electrical and 
electronic products. Correct disposal helps prevent negative consequences for 
the environment and human health.
